Newly-signed Patriots tight end Mike Gesicki joins an offense that, depending on who you ask, may be dealing with questions at quarterback. This offseason has featured waves of stories about how the team views incumbent starter Mac Jones, and promising backup Bailey Zappe.

Gesicki is seemingly aware of the budding quarterback controversy building in Foxborough. When asked about Jones on Thursday when speaking with Patriots media for the first time, he made sure to cover all the bases.

  • “Really cool dude. cool personality I love the energy and the juice that he brings out to some throwing sessions and all that kind of stuff. And then obviously – great arm, accurate, all that kind of stuff,” Gesicki joked. He then added “I’m making sure I check all the boxes because I know everybody’s going to want to talk about it.”

    “But he’s awesome,” Gesicki continued. “Really excited to continue to work with him.”

    Gesicki kept the positivity going when he was asked about Zappe. That came on the very next question.

  • “Same thing. Bailey’s awesome. Love just talking with him,” Gesicki replied. He even continued to shout out the other quarterbacks on the roster, who are currently free agency signing Trace McSorley and UDFA Malik Cunningham. “Getting to know everybody – all the quarterbacks are great. Everybody’s been very welcoming. So it’s been really exciting to kind of get to know everybody.”

    If there was one time Gesicki wasn’t complimentary of his new quarterbacks, it was discussing dance moves. Gesicki and Jones both went viral for celebrating touchdown dances with the ‘Griddy’ in recent  years. Asked whose dance was better, Gesicki said “both could probably use some work.”

    The Patriots are hoping both Jones and Gesicki have plenty to dance about in 2023. Gesicki, along with wide receiver JuJu Smith-Schuster, were the team’s two high-profile offensive additions this offseason as they try to improve a unit that ranked 17th in the league in scoring last year.
